Let N and P be smooth manifolds of dimensions n and p (n \geq p \geq 2) respectively. Let \Omega(N,P) denote an open subspace of J^{infty}(N,P) which consists of all regular jets and jets with prescribed singularities of types A_{i}, D_{j} and E_{k}. An \Omega-regular map f:N \to P refers to a smooth map having only singularities in \Omega(N,P) and satisfy the transversality condition. We will prove the homotopy principle in the existence level for \Omega-regular maps.
